Our Middle School program is designed to prepare students for high school and future academic success. At this level, we place greater emphasis on developing strong writing skills, mathematical reasoning, and critical thinking abilities through both inductive and deductive reasoning exercises. Our supportive environment helps students build confidence in these advanced skills while maintaining the personalized approach that allows each student to progress at their own pace and learning style.
All classes at the Lyman School benefit from low student-to-teacher ratios and individualized learning plans. This intentional design ensures that every child is known, seen, and supported as a unique learner rather than one of many. With smaller class sizes, our teachers have the time and capacity to truly understand how each student thinks, learns, and grows.
Individualized learning plans are at the heart of the Lyman experience. Developed in partnership with families and updated regularly, these dynamic roadmaps honor each student’s strengths, address areas for growth, and align with their personal interests and long-term goals. Whether a child needs enrichment in mathematics, additional support in literacy, or the freedom to explore advanced topics at an accelerated pace, the plan flexes with them.
